Transaction c53ad1676516fff860bf954198c76ebeedc4917224a58e32ad94447c19da9f33
1 Input
2 Outputs
- c53ad1676516fff860bf954198c76ebeedc4917224a58e32ad94447c19da9f33:0
- c53ad1676516fff860bf954198c76ebeedc4917224a58e32ad94447c19da9f33:1
value 1097213
address 3BRTsEvKjYiPZdDr2TT3ynfZVJpv7p4g6g
value 1225335064
address 15iUv5ZfZgz7f396PQNoha3r81m9kt4rbj